What is a remote product designer?

A Remote Product Designer is responsible for creating user-friendly and visually appealing digital products while working from a remote location. They collaborate with cross-functional teams, including developers, product managers, and UX researchers, to design interfaces that enhance user experience. Their role involves wireframing, prototyping, and working with design tools like Figma or Sketch. Strong communication skills are essential for presenting ideas and gathering feedback in a remote environment.

What is a typical day like for a remote product designer?

As a Remote Product Designer, your typical day often includes collaborating with cross-functional teams through virtual meetings, creating and refining design prototypes, and conducting user research or usability testing remotely. You may spend time reviewing feedback from stakeholders, iterating on wireframes, and documenting design decisions to ensure clarity across global teams. Effective time management and proactive communication are essential since much of your work is self-directed within flexible hours. This structure allows for both creative focus and close coordination with colleagues regardless of time zone or location.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ote product designer?

To thrive as a Remote Product Designer, you need expertise in user experience (UX) and user interface (UI) design, backed by a portfolio demonstrating end-to-end product design and typically a degree in design or a related field. Proficiency with technical tools such as Figma, Sketch, Adobe Creative Suite, and familiarity with prototyping and collaboration platforms is common. Strong communication skills, self-motivation, and the ability to collaborate effectively in distributed teams help candidates excel in remote settings. These skills are vital to transform user needs into intuitive digital products while maintaining productivity and alignment in a virtual work environment.

Job description

We're looking for an exceptional Staff Product Designer to help craft the future of Oura across surfaces. You'll help define new product experiences, elevate existing ones, and shape how millions of people engage with their health.

This role is built for a generalist at heart: a designer who's equally at home prototyping a bold new concept, refining a high-visibility consumer flow, or untangling a technical, workflow-heavy problem into something that feels simple. You'll partner closely with Product, Engineering, Research, and Data Science, and with a design team that puts the work, and each other, first.

This is a hybrid role based out of our San Francisco office, with an expectation to be on-site at least half-time.

What you'll do
  • Lead end-to-end design of complex product experiences, driving 01 initiatives from early concepts through polished, production-ready work
  • Move fluidly across very different problem spaces: consumer-facing experiences, data-dense and technical products, and new AI-powered capabilities
  • Transform complex, sensitive information into experiences that feel clear, trustworthy, and human
  • Shape product strategy and influence direction through strong design rationale and excellent storytelling
  • Raise the bar for the whole team through mentorship, critique, and a genuine investment in the people around you
What you'll bring
  • 8+ years designing digital products, with demonstrated range across surfaces and problem types - including high-craft consumer work and technical or data-rich products
  • A portfolio demonstrating exceptional visual and interaction design, with a track record of shipping 01 products
  • Experience designing outside an established design system-ideally you've helped build or scale one from scratch
  • An entrepreneurial mindset: you take ownership, create clarity in ambiguity, and push work forward without waiting for permission
  • Genuine enthusiasm for AI as a design material-you're proactive with AI tools in your process
  • A team-first spirit: you make the people and the work around you better, and you'd rather win together than be right alone
  • Fluency in Figma, modern prototyping tools and design workflows
  • Comfort working across distributed teams and time zones
We love
  • Experience designing in health, wellness, or other data-sensitive spaces where trust is earned in the details
  • Designers who've shipped LLM-powered products and have a point of view on where these capabilities create real user value
  • A background that mixes founding-designer or startup work with time at a larger, established company; agency experience is a plus
